Brosmind Exhibits Its Bubbly Product Aesthetic in Taipei

This attention-captivating interactive design exhibition was held in the Zhongzheng district of Taipei, Taiwan and it paid tribute to a decade's worth of work by Barcelona-based creative studio Brosmind.

The exhibitors — Juan and Alejandro Mingarro, have become known for their absolutely whimsical approach to product development. From nostalgia-inducing gadgets to bubbly illustrations and sculptures, the brother duo is exceptionally expressive. The event featured some of Brosmind's most notable projects and it gave visitors a sneak peek at the brother's creative processes and their personal lives in Barcelona.

The interactive design exhibition is quite typical for the studio, as audience engagement is an incredibly important feature to Brosmind. Visitors had the opportunity to "play videogames, visit the space riding the Brosmind motorbikes," and even "become one of the ingredients of a huge sandwich."
